# Design Patterns Final Project
## Synopsis
### Course
- [CCSU F20 CS Design Patterns](https://github.com/CCSU-DesignPatterns-F20/DesignPatternsCourseInfo)
### Team Members
1. [Caleb ABG](https://github.com/CalebABG)
2. [Camilo Espinosa](https://github.com/Camiloesp)
3. [Raymond Farrell](https://github.com/RayTFarrell)
### Goal
- Wanted to be able to compare many sorting algorithms visually
- Have our codebase be flexible enough so that more algorithms could be added / implemented, and at the same time keeping maintainability of the code
### Outcome
- Had to put the visuals (visualizer) on hold. Due to the time window and complexity of our project, we decided to put implementing the design patterns listed below as the top priority

## Running the Project
### Prerequisites
1. **Java JDK 8 or Java JRE 8** - Minimum due to use of lambda functions
2. Any text editor or IDE of your choice
#### Editors and IDE's I highly recommend:
1. [IntelliJ IDEA](https://www.jetbrains.com/idea/)
2. [Visual Studio Code](https://code.visualstudio.com/)
3. [Eclipse](https://eclipse.org/)
### Viewing the Test Suite Output
1. Once you've gotten the [prerequisites](#prerequisites) out the way, head over to the ```test``` package inside the ```src``` folder (full path = ```src\test``` )
2. Then just run or debug the ```Test.java``` file to see the output of the different test for our design patterns we implemented

## Design Patterns Implemented in Project
- Abstract Factory
- Factory Method
- Iterator
- Memento
- Decorator
- Strategy
- Builder
- Prototype
## Frameworks or Structures Used
- Heavy use of Generics
- Java's Collections framework
